What do you do when someone shares something on the screen that you don't want?
Hide Screen
- On the instructor's touch panel in the classroom, click "Hide Screen."
- Note: When a new wireless projection session begins, a new PIN Code is issued.
Force End Session
- You can also click the green "Force End Session" button if someone forgets to stop their wireless projection sharing.

Moderation
- You could also use the "Moderate" option within the Solstice App.
Note: Using Moderation for student sharing is not recommended, as Moderation Alerts don't display properly each time.
- After connecting to the display, go to the "Moderator Menu" and activate the toggle switch for "Moderate Meeting."
- Note: If the side menu collapses and covers the words, look for the icons on the left.

- When someone else tries to join the display, an Alert will be sent to your Solstice App. As the Moderator, you can Approve or Deny from that screen. Then, the student will get a waiting screen as they wait to get approved.

- Once approved, the student will be connected and granted options to share their screen. After completing their screen-sharing session, they will be able to disconnect.
- To view the list of connected students, select "Layout" from the menu. Click on the person icon to see the name of the person sharing and get options to show, hide, or delete their post(s). Additionally, you can choose to stack the posts for someone sharing multiple screens. You can also drag a post to the left side of the layout window to hide it.

To share audio or video with audio during class, you can do so through Mersive Solstice. The first time you share audio, you may be prompted to download drivers and restart the Solstice app.
- Connect to the Solstice App.
- In the left menu, select "Settings."
- Click "Control" and ensure "Auto Share Audio" is on.

- If prompted, click "Yes" to install the audio driver. Once the driver is installed, you will not be prompted to install it again.

- Follow the onscreen instructions to install the drivers. Click "Continue" to move through the installation.
- When installation is complete, you will be prompted to quit Solstice and restart the app.
- Whenever you share content with audio, it will automatically play.

Mac OS Permissions
On Mac OS, you must allow the client to record your desktop. Share your desktop or app window, navigate to System Preferences > Security & Privacy > Privacy tab > Screen Recording, and check the box beside Mersive Solstice. If Mersive Solstice is not listed, restart your computer, reconnect to the display using the client, and check back in the screen recording section.
